N.R.S. 298.023 - “Alternate” defined
Overview of Statute
This defines “alternate.”
Statute
“Alternate” means a person selected pursuant to NRS 298.035 to be an alternate to a nominee for presidential elector.
(Added to NRS by 2013, 1230)
1. Definition for Nominee for presidential elector
A person selected pursuant to NRS 298.035 to be a nominee to the position of presidential elector by a major political party, a minor political party or an independent candidate nominated for the office of President pursuant to NRS 298.109.
See Nev. Rev. Stat. § 298.028.
2. Definition for Person
1. A natural person;
2. Any form of business or social organization;
3. Any nongovernmental legal entity, including, without limitation, a corporation, partnership, association, trust, unincorporated organization, labor union, committee for political action, political party and committee sponsored by a political party; or
4. A government, governmental agency or political subdivision of a government.
See Nev. Rev. Stat. § 294A.009.
3. Definition for Elector
A person who is eligible to vote under the provisions of Section 1 of Article 2 of the Constitution of the State of Nevada.
See Nev. Rev. Stat. § 293.055.
